Output f9161dae6fd7edd559c9a63defe318df097b2e606491e7e8af649e191228f2a0:28

value
5140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375064a369146970577a1b1a801bdbf19de44 OP_EQUAL
address
3BMEXPD24dZ65x5aageBmySmSb4EwHqR47
transaction
f9161dae6fd7edd559c9a63defe318df097b2e606491e7e8af649e191228f2a0
confirmations
280138
spent
true